Solution for 5(3x-4)-12=6x-10 equation:


Simplifying
5(3x + -4) + -12 = 6x + -10

Reorder the terms:
5(-4 + 3x) + -12 = 6x + -10
(-4 * 5 + 3x * 5) + -12 = 6x + -10
(-20 + 15x) + -12 = 6x + -10

Reorder the terms:
-20 + -12 + 15x = 6x + -10

Combine like terms: -20 + -12 = -32
-32 + 15x = 6x + -10

Reorder the terms:
-32 + 15x = -10 + 6x

Solving
-32 + 15x = -10 + 6x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-6x' to each side of the equation.
-32 + 15x + -6x = -10 + 6x + -6x

Combine like terms: 15x + -6x = 9x
-32 + 9x = -10 + 6x + -6x

Combine like terms: 6x + -6x = 0
-32 + 9x = -10 + 0
-32 + 9x = -10

Add '32' to each side of the equation.
-32 + 32 + 9x = -10 + 32

Combine like terms: -32 + 32 = 0
0 + 9x = -10 + 32
9x = -10 + 32

Combine like terms: -10 + 32 = 22
9x = 22

Divide each side by '9'.
x = 2.444444444

Simplifying
x = 2.444444444
